The brake adjustments levers inside the drums are different. RS Turbos had a bigger brake, therefore most of the parts are different, back plates, drums, shoes etc. Parts catalogue won't tell me what the difference is, just that RS Turbos had their own brake adjustment levers and seems like these were just used for the S2.

yes they are. Xr3i has 203MM drums Rsturbo has 228mm drum.. the adjuster from xr3i is not long enough for the rst rear brake. I am looking for the length or rst adjuster. I think I have fixed it. I have cut xr3i adjuster and added in 15mm and welded it up. I now have handbrake and all works great
